1. ホーム
  2. reactjs

[解決済み】チェックボックスのReactJSでデフォルトのCheckedを設定する方法は?

2022-04-06 04:34:35

質問

チェックボックスにデフォルト値が割り当てられた後、状態を更新するのに苦労しています。 checked="checked" をReactで作成しました。

var rCheck = React.createElement('input',
    {
        type: 'checkbox',
        checked: 'checked',
        value: true
    }, 'Check here');

を割り当てた後 checked="checked" チェックボックスをクリックすると、チェックが外れたり、チェックが入ったりします。

どうすればいいですか?

チェックボックスが React.createElement の場合、プロパティ defaultChecked が使用されます。

React.createElement('input',{type: 'checkbox', defaultChecked: false});

クレジット:@nash_ag